跳到主要內容

透過向下探查圖層控制可見地圖資料

在此頁面

透過向下探查圖層控制可見地圖資料

此範例將顯示如何為地圖建立上層區域圖層,並使用兩個點圖層向下探查。

建立具有多個位於各個地理區域之資料點的地圖時,您可以使用向下探查維度以顯示階層中的圖層。使用者在圖層中進行選取時,顯示在圖層中的維度會變更為向下探查維度中的下一個維度。這可讓您在地圖內於不同的選項層級使用顯示資料,確保只會顯示最相關的資訊。

我們擁有美國國家公園管理局的國家史蹟名錄的所有史蹟清單。將史蹟的所在城市新增至地圖作為點圖層時,泡泡也會取得精確位置。不過,這可透過較好的組織方式讓人更能夠理解。

Map with point layer.

接著我們能夠如何以更好的方式組織此資訊,特別是若我們也想要在另一個包含機場的點圖層中新增,以協助計畫如何抵達不同的地點?

為了解決此問題,我們會建立美國地圖,這具有州圖層,並可向下探查到縣層級。向下探查到縣層級也會以資料點顯示包含史蹟的城市,以及該州和周圍的州的所有機場。

Map with drill down layer displaying counties in USA.

Map with drill down layer displaying counties in USA and cities and airports as data points.

資料集

此範例使用兩個資料集:

  • Federal listings: National Register of Historic Places listed properties from federal agencies (federal_listed_20190404.xlsx)

    此資料集由國家公園管理局的國家史蹟名錄提供使用。這包含關於所有史蹟名錄、其位置以及相關聯邦機關的資料。

    federal_listed_20190404.xlsx.

  • Airport data

    此表格包含美國境內機場的資料。其中含有每個機場的國際航空運輸協會 (IATA) 代碼、城市和州或領土。

    您必須將此資料新增至隨後匯入 Qlik Sense 的試算表,或由此說明頁面作為網頁式檔案匯入表格,以將此資料匯入 Qlik Sense

說明

Qlik Sense 中將資料集載入新的應用程式後,即可開始建立地圖。若要製作範例地圖,必須完成下列任務: 

  1. 建立向下探查維度。
  2. 將地圖新增至工作表。
  3. 新增 State-County 區域圖層。
  4. 新增 State-City 點圖層。
  5. 新增 State-Airport 點圖層。
  6. 新增 Resource 篩選窗格。

建立向下探查維度

首先,您需要建立三個向下探查維度。這將會建立 State 以及欄位 CountyCityAirport 之間的關係,讓 CountyCityAirport 圖層能夠在選取 State 圖層中的州之後顯示。

請執行下列動作:

  1. 在工作表檢視中,按一下工具列中的 @ 編輯工作表
  2. 按一下 é 以顯示主項目。
  3. 按一下維度
  4. 按一下新建
  5. 選取向下探查
  6. 將欄位 State 新增到維度。
  7. 將欄位 County 新增到維度。
  8. 名稱之後,輸入 State-County
  9. 按一下建立。.
  10. 將欄位 State 新增到維度。
  11. 將欄位 City 新增到維度。
  12. 名稱之後,輸入 State-City
  13. 按一下建立。.
  14. 將欄位 State 新增到維度。
  15. 將欄位 Airport 新增到維度。
  16. 名稱之後,輸入 State-Airport
  17. 按一下建立。.
  18. 按一下 完成編輯

將地圖新增至工作表

下一步是將地圖新增至工作表。

請執行下列動作:

  1. 在工作表檢視中,按一下工具列中的 @ 編輯工作表

  2. 從資產面板中,將空白地圖拖曳至工作表。

新增 State-County 區域圖層

第一個您新增的圖層是區域圖層,對此您可新增維度 State-County。此外,您可將國家設定為 'USA',以確保對應至喬治亞州,而非喬治亞國家。

請執行下列動作:

  1. 從屬性面板中的圖層,按一下新增圖層
  2. 選取區域圖層
  3. 維度中,按一下新增,然後選取 State-County
  4. 按一下位置
  5. 位置範圍設定為自訂
  6. 國家後,輸入 'USA'
  7. 行政區域 (層級 1) 後,選取 State
  8. 按一下色彩
  9. 色彩設定為自訂,選取按照維度,然後選取100 種色彩
  10. 選取固定色彩
  11. 調整不透明度 滑桿至半透明度。
  12. 按一下 完成編輯

新增 State-City 點圖層

下一個您新增的圖層是點圖層。您可新增 State-City 作為維度,然後將國家設定為 'USA',然後將 State 設定為第一層級的行政區域,因為有些國家城市在不同的州中有相同的名稱。

請執行下列動作:

  1. 從屬性面板中的圖層,按一下新增圖層
  2. 選取區域圖層
  3. 維度中,按一下新增,然後選取 State-City
  4. 按一下位置
  5. 位置範圍設定為自訂
  6. 國家後,輸入 'USA'
  7. 行政區域 (層級 1) 後,選取 State
  8. 按一下色彩
  9. 色彩設定為自訂,選取單一色彩,然後選取一種色彩。
  10. 按一下選項
  11. 圖層顯示中,將可見向下探查層級設定為自訂
  12. 清除狀態
  13. 按一下 完成編輯

新增 State-Airport 點圖層

您新增至地圖的最後一個圖層是點圖層,對此您可新增 State-Airport 欄位作為維度。Qlik Sense 辨識 IATA 代碼進行置放,確保機場位於實際位置,而非只是位於所在城市當中。

請執行下列動作:

  1. 從屬性面板中的圖層,按一下新增圖層
  2. 選取區域圖層
  3. 維度中,按一下新增,然後選取 State-Airport
  4. 按一下位置
  5. 位置範圍設定為自訂
  6. 國家後,輸入 'USA'
  7. 行政區域 (層級 1) 後,選取 State
  8. 按一下大小和圖形
  9. 圖形中,選取三角形
  10. 按一下色彩
  11. 色彩設定為自訂,選取單一色彩,然後選取一種色彩。
  12. 按一下選項
  13. 圖層顯示中,將可見向下探查層級設定為自訂
  14. 清除狀態
  15. 按一下 完成編輯

新增 Resource 篩選窗格

最後,您可以選擇新增包含欄位 Resource 的篩選窗格。這會在您於地圖中進行選取時提供可用史蹟清單。

請執行下列動作:

  1. 在資產面板中,將篩選窗格拖放至工作表中。
  2. 按一下新增維度
  3. 新增包含欄位 Resource 的篩選窗格。